Hail of Stone does 1d4 untyped damage per caster level ( max 5d4)
Can I use Snowcasting and Energy Admixture Acid to add another 5d4 damage?

Reserves of Strength to remove the CL cap, Sculpt Spell to make the area bigger, pump CL to play "Rocks fall, everyone dies" for no save, no SR direct damage
